Producer overview
Shwe Taung Thu is a coffee producer located in Myanmar. Their coffee is cultivated within the Shwe Taung Thu region at an altitude of 1200 meters.
The producer focuses on the Catuai varietal. This variety is the primary cultivar represented across their catalog entries.
The processing portfolio for Shwe Taung Thu is centered on the natural process. All three lots currently documented in the index utilize this specific method.
The catalog footprint for this producer includes three distinct lots, which have been featured by two different roasters. Recent catalog entries include the A Lel Chaung lot, processed as a natural Catuai and featured by both Tres Cabezas and 19grams.
The work of Shwe Taung Thu is defined by a consistent focus on the natural processing of the Catuai varietal.
